Just some updates from the Charleston area. Having not been in WV for the last couple of years has left me out of the loop, but I know of a few things going on around the area which have been neglected.

Dunkin Donuts in Hurricane is open (I believe it opened in September) and the manager says that expansion into Charleston is going to eventually happen. Combination Little General Store, Dunkin' Donuts Opens In Hurricane - WCHS - ABC

Energy Corporation of America has built and completed their new Eastern Division HQ at Northgate Business Park. I don't even know if this has been made known on here, but I've seen a few pictures and it is a very beautiful and contemporary looking building. (SORRY NO LINK)

Eagle View (once to be a top tier subdivision) has been developed into condos/apartments. Actually probably Charleston's largest complex of its type, with outstanding views of the city and valley as a whole. Eagle View: Apartments & Town Homes in Charleston, WV

MVB Bank's four story office building in downtown is complete (or at least on the outside). Not my favorite building.
corny video extra I found if anyone is interested
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=AmNYojQty7k&safe=active

Courtyard by Marriott in downtown is almost complete and is scheduled to open very soon. Of course, we all know how that kind of stuff goes.

Wendy's is building a new location in Saint Albans to replace their old one.

Krogers at Ashton Place has been finished for a while, and the last time I was in tow I went in at it was the bomb! They remodeled the Teays Valley location as well, but I haven't seen it personally.

Taco Bell is opening locations in Winfield and Belle. No idea what there status is.

Aldi is under construction in Scott Depot. Should be a nice and bigger store.
